VS Series Component Leak Detector
17. On the PCB, use the resistance meter to verify an open circuit between any two of the
six ion source header pins (except FIL-1 to FIL-1 and FIL-2 to FIL-2 which should be 0.3
Ohms or less). Also verify an open circuit between the body of the spectrometer and any
of the ion source header pins (Figure B-56). If there is continuity (short circuit) at any of
the points, remove the header and inspect for shorting.
Figure B-56 Ion Source Header Pin Schematic
18. Re-Install the cover with the four screws.
19. Re-plug in both cables and ground strap.
20. Verify that turbo vent valve is closed.
21. Leak check the spectrometer to ensure a leak free joint.
22. Close the cover and secure using existing hardware.
23. Power up the leak detector.
24. Let the unit run for 20 minutes, then perform a calibration (via the I/O, front panel
display or RS232), per the user manual, to validate a successful installation.
